16-25-150
Section 16-25-150 Participation in plan. (a) As governed by this subsection, there exists as
a part of this retirement system an optional account known as the Deferred Retirement Option
Plan, which may be cited as "DROP." The purpose of DROP is to allow, contractually,
in lieu of immediate withdrawal from service and receipt of a retirement allowance, continued
employment for a specific period of time, coupled with the deferral of receipt of a retirement
allowance until the end of the period of participation, at which time the member shall withdraw
from service. (b) Participation in DROP is an option available to any member of this retirement
system who meets all of the following requirements: (1) Has at least 25 years of creditable
service exclusive of sick leave. (2) Is at least 55 years of age. (3) Is eligible for service
retirement. (c) An election to participate in DROP may be made in one year increments not
to exceed five years, nor to be less than three years. A member may...

16-25-41
Section 16-25-41 Persons whose date of retirement is prior to October 1, 1987 or beneficiaries
of deceased members or retirees entitled to cost-of-living increases - Additional adjustments.
In addition to the foregoing amount an additional cost-of-living adjustment is provided effective
October 1, 1989 as follows: (1) One dollar per month for each year of service attained by
said retiree for each retiree selecting the maximum retirement allowance or Option 1. (2)
One dollar per month for each year of service attained by said retiree reduced by the retiree's
option election factor for each retiree selecting Options 2, 3 or 4. (3) One dollar per month
for each year of service attained by said deceased member or deceased retiree reduced by the
survivor's option factor for each beneficiary receiving monthly benefits from the Teachers'
Retirement System. (Acts 1988, No. 88-600, p. 932, ยง2.)...
